Mastering Remote Connections: A Comprehensive Guide to Connecting to a Computer Over the Internet

In our digital age, the ability to connect to a computer remotely over the internet has transformed how we work, share resources, and manage tasks. Whether you’re troubleshooting a friend’s computer, accessing office files from home, or providing tech support, understanding how to connect remotely is essential. In this elaborate guide, we will dive deep into the various methods, tools, and best practices to establish a remote connection securely and effectively.

Understanding Remote Connections

Before we delve into the specifics, it is crucial to understand what remote connection means. A remote connection allows users to operate a computer from a different location using the internet. This is made possible through various software solutions, each with its own set of features, protocols, and security measures.

Types of Remote Connections

There are primarily two types of remote connections you will encounter:

  • Desktop Sharing: This method involves sharing the screen of a computer with another user. The remote user can see everything the host user sees.
  • Remote Desktop Control: In this scenario, the remote user can control the host computer as if they were sitting right in front of it. This level of access often allows for file transfers, software management, and more.

Understanding these primary types will help you choose the right tool for your needs.

Selecting the Right Remote Connection Software

The choice of software is pivotal in establishing a reliable remote connection. Here, we will explore some noteworthy options :

Popular Remote Access Tools

  1. TeamViewer
  2. Easy to use, supports cross-platform connections.
  3. Offers features such as file transfer, remote printing, and session recording.

  4. AnyDesk

  5. Lightweight and quick to set up.
  6. Excellent for lower bandwidth situations with high-quality video.

  7. Chrome Remote Desktop

  8. A free and user-friendly tool that integrates with the Google ecosystem.
  9. Great for quick access if you’re using a Google account.

  10. Microsoft Remote Desktop

  11. Built into Windows, making it seamless for Windows users.
  12. Ideal for connecting to a Windows host from another Windows computer, macOS, or mobile devices.

  13. LogMeIn

  14. A paid solution that offers robust features including file sharing and remote printing.
  15. Suitable for business environments with a focus on security.

Evaluating Features

When choosing the right remote connection software, consider the following key factors:

FeatureTeamViewerAnyDeskChrome Remote DesktopMicrosoft Remote DesktopLogMeIn
CostFree for personal use, paid for businessFree for personal use, paid for businessFreeFree for basic functionality, Windows Pro requiredPaid
Platform CompatibilityCross-platformCross-platformWeb-basedWindows, macOS, mobileCross-platform
Ease of UseVery user-friendlyIntuitive interfaceSimple and straightforwardMore technical setupUser-friendly
Security FeaturesEnd-to-end encryptionBank-level encryptionEncrypted connectionsBuilt-in Remote Desktop Protocol securityEnd-to-end encryption with 2FA

Each option has its pros and cons, but having a clear understanding of your needs will help you make the right choice.

Setting Up a Remote Connection

Now that you’ve chosen your software, let’s walk through the setup process for a typical remote connection scenario.

Step-by-Step Guide to Setting Up Remote Desktop Using TeamViewer

  1. Download and Install TeamViewer
  2. Go to the official TeamViewer website and download the software.
  3. Follow the prompts to install on both the computer you are connecting to (remote) and the computer you are connecting from (local).

  4. Launch TeamViewer

  5. Open the application on both computers.
  6. The remote computer will display a unique ID and password.

  7. Connect Remotely

  8. On the local computer, input the remote ID in the “Partner ID” field.
  9. Click “Connect.”
  10. Enter the password given by the remote computer when prompted.

  11. Establish the Connection

  12. Once the password is accepted, you’ll have access to the remote computer’s desktop.
  13. You can now navigate through files, applications, and settings as if you’re physically present.

Configuring Security Settings

Security is paramount when connecting to a computer remotely. Follow these best practices to enhance security:

  • Use Strong Passwords: Ensure the remote computer uses robust passwords and change them periodically.
  • Two-Factor Authentication: Enable two-factor authentication (2FA) whenever available. This serves as an additional layer of security.

Using Remote Desktop Protocol (RDP) on Windows

For users of Microsoft Windows, connecting to a remote desktop using Remote Desktop Protocol (RDP) is an effective solution. Here’s how to set it up:

Step-by-Step Guide to Using Microsoft Remote Desktop

  1. Prepare the Remote Computer
  2. Enable Remote Desktop: Go to Settings > System > Remote Desktop and toggle on “Enable Remote Desktop.”
  3. Note Computer Name: Under “How to connect to this PC,” note the computer name displayed.

  4. Allow Remote Desktop Through the Firewall

  5. Ensure Windows Firewall allows Remote Desktop connections. You can check this in the Firewall settings found in the Control Panel.

  6. Connect from Another Computer

  7. Open the Remote Desktop Connection application on your local computer (this is built into Windows).
  8. Enter the remote computer’s name and click “Connect.”
  9. Enter the username and password when prompted.

  10. Establish Connection

  11. Upon successful authentication, you’ll have full access to the remote machine.

Best Practices for Using RDP

For optimal performance and security during RDP sessions, consider the following recommendations:

  1. Keep Software Updated: Regularly update your Windows operating system and any remote access software to mitigate vulnerabilities.

  2. Limit User Access: Only allow specific user accounts to access the remote machine, thus minimizing the number of points of entry.

Establishing Remote Connections on Mobile Devices

In today’s mobile world, the ability to connect remotely using smartphones or tablets can be indispensable. Here’s how you can achieve this.

Using Remote Access Apps on Mobile

Most remote desktop solutions provide mobile applications. For instance, if you’re using TeamViewer, simply download the app from your device’s app store. The setup process is similar to that of desktop applications:

  1. Download the App: Visit the Google Play Store or Apple App Store and download your chosen remote access app.

  2. Log In: Once installed, launch the app and log in using the same account used on the desktop application.

  3. Connect to the Remote Device: Enter the unique ID and password for the remote computer.

  4. Control the Remote Device: You can now view and control your remote desktop right from your mobile device.

Troubleshooting Common Issues

Even with the best-planned setups, you might encounter challenges when connecting remotely. Here are some common issues and their solutions:

Connection Issues

  1. Network Connectivity: Ensure both devices have stable internet connections. A weak connection can disrupt your session.

  2. Incorrect Credentials: Double-check the ID and password. Typographical errors can prevent access.

  3. Firewall Settings: Confirm that your firewall allows incoming connections for the remote access software.

  4. Software Updates: Ensure all software is updated to avoid compatibility issues.

Conclusion

Connecting remotely to a computer over the internet opens up a world of possibilities for work, communication, and troubleshooting. With a wide array of tools available, it is essential to select software that aligns with your specific needs and follow best practices for security and performance. By mastering the setup and appropriate use of remote connections, you can enhance your productivity, provide support effortlessly, and navigate the digital landscape with confidence. Whether using desktop solutions like TeamViewer, AnyDesk, or Microsoft Remote Desktop, or opting for mobile applications, the potential to bridge distances and work seamlessly across platforms is now at your fingertips.

Embrace these technologies, and you’ll find that the world of remote connectivity is not just convenient, but also a game-changer in how we operate in our increasingly digital society.

What is remote connection?

A remote connection allows a user to access and control a computer from a different location over the Internet. This technology lets individuals work on their devices as if they were physically present in front of them, enabling efficient management of tasks and services from virtually anywhere. Common use cases include technical support, remote work, and accessing files on a work computer when away from the office.

To establish a remote connection, specific software applications or services are typically used. These programs facilitate secure communication between the host and the client device, ensuring data privacy and integrity during the remote session. Popular tools for remote connection include TeamViewer, AnyDesk, and Microsoft Remote Desktop.

What software do I need for remote connections?

To create a remote connection, you need dedicated software that enables remote desktop sharing and control. Several options are available, including commercial software like TeamViewer and AnyDesk, as well as built-in solutions like Microsoft Remote Desktop for Windows or Screen Sharing for Mac. Each of these applications offers unique features tailored to various user needs.

Before selecting the right software, consider factors such as ease of use, security protocols, system compatibility, and whether the software meets your specific requirements. Many of these tools come with free trials, allowing you to assess their functionality and user interface before committing to a purchase.

How secure are remote connections?

Security is a critical concern when it comes to remote connections, given that they involve accessing sensitive information over the Internet. Most reputable remote access software employs strong encryption protocols, such as AES (Advanced Encryption Standard), to protect data during transmission. Additionally, many programs offer features like two-factor authentication, ensuring that only authorized users can initiate a remote session.

While modern remote connection tools are designed with security in mind, users must also take steps to protect their devices. This includes regularly updating software to patch vulnerabilities, using strong and unique passwords, and ensuring firewalls and antivirus software are active. Following best practices will help mitigate risks and provide a more secure remote connection experience.

Can I connect to a computer remotely without a local network?

Yes, it is entirely possible to connect to a computer remotely without being on the same local network. Remote connection software is designed to establish connections over the Internet, allowing users to access their devices regardless of geographical location. The most common approach is to use a cloud-based solution that handles connections over the Internet seamlessly.

To connect without a local network, you will typically need an active Internet connection on both the remote device and the target computer. After installing the appropriate remote access software on both ends, users can establish a connection by entering the required credentials or connection ID, enabling full control of the remote system.

What are the common use cases for remote connection?

Remote connections are versatile and can be used in various scenarios. One of the most prevalent use cases is for remote work, where employees access their office computers from home or while traveling. This allows them to retrieve files, run applications, and continue their work without interruption, ensuring productivity is maintained.

Additionally, remote support is another significant application. IT professionals often use remote connections to troubleshoot and resolve issues on client machines without needing to be physically present. This method speeds up the support process and can often lead to quicker resolution of technical problems, improving overall service delivery.

Is it possible to access multiple computers remotely?

Yes, it is indeed feasible to access multiple computers remotely using the right tools and configurations. Most remote access software allows users to set up multiple client connections through a single interface. This can be particularly useful for IT support teams managing multiple devices within an organization or for users with more than one personal computer.

To facilitate access to multiple computers, you need to ensure that each machine is set up with the remote access software and configured correctly. This often includes enabling remote access features, ensuring network settings permit connections, and properly managing user permissions to maintain control over who can access which device.

Do I need a static IP address to connect remotely?

While having a static IP address can simplify the process of connecting to a computer remotely, it is not a strict requirement. A static IP address remains constant, making it easier for remote access software to locate the target device on the Internet. However, most dynamic IP addresses assigned by Internet Service Providers (ISPs) can change frequently, complicating remote connections.

Fortunately, several solutions exist for users without a static IP address. Dynamic DNS (DDNS) services can help mitigate this issue by providing a consistent hostname that maps to your changing IP address, allowing remote access tools to connect regardless of IP changes. Using remote access software capable of handling dynamic IP addresses can also provide reliable connections without the need for a static address.

What troubleshooting steps can I take if my remote connection fails?

If a remote connection fails, there are several troubleshooting steps you can take to identify and resolve the issue. Start by checking your Internet connection on both the host and client devices to ensure they are online. Next, verify that the remote access software is installed and running correctly on both machines, as well as confirming that both systems are updated with the latest software versions.

If your connection still fails, check the firewall settings on the host computer to ensure that it is not blocking the remote access application. Additionally, you may want to verify that the correct credentials (username and password) are being used, and revisit the configurations to ensure that remote access features are properly enabled. Consulting the software documentation or support can also provide further guidance.

Leave a Comment